82-14-01 HUGHES: Amendment 39-4402. Applies to the Hughes Model 369 Helicopters with Chadwick C-20 Auxiliary Fuel System installed per Supplemental Type Certification SH129WE. Compliance is required as indicated, to provide early warning of auxiliary fuel transfer pump malfunction and the associated decrease in usable auxiliary fuel. Accomplish the following, unless already accomplished:
1. Within 30 days after the effective date of this AD, install a placard in accordance with Chadwick Service Bulletin 20-81-01 dated October 6, 1981, or FAA approved equivalent limiting usable auxiliary fuel to half the amount in the auxiliary tanks at takeoff.
2. Within 300 hours' time-in-service or 6 months from the effective date of this AD, whichever occurs first, install the C-20-FM Flow Monitoring Kit in accordance with Chadwick Service Bulletin 20-81-01 dated October 6, 1981, or FAA approved equivalent. The placard installed per Item 1 above may be removed, provided the revisedFlight Manual Supplement, Chadwick Auxiliary Fuel System C-20, dated October 21, 1981, is incorporated into the Rotorcraft Flight Manual.
3. Alternate modifications or other actions which provide an equivalent level of safety may be used when approved by the Chief, Seattle Area Aircraft Certification Office, FAA Northwest Mountain Region.
4. Special flight permits may be issued in accordance with Federal Aviation Regulation Part 21, Sections 21.197 and 21.199, to operate each helicopter to a base for the accomplishment of the modification required by this AD.
This amendment becomes effective July 30, 1982.
